WebSep 12, 2024 · Hives can seem to be caused by nothing. This happens when the trigger behind hives cannot be found after reviewing lifestyle, environment, or possible allergens. Hives that appear to have no reason usually disappear on their own, though if they are chronic (lasting longer than six weeks), medication can help manage the symptoms. WebHives come in various shapes and sizes. Individual hives can be as small as one millimeter or as large as 6 to 8 inches in diameter. Someone can have a single hive or a few hives in a single location on the body.
